New Video: Joel Grey and Eddie Redmayne Talk CABARET and The 'Emcee' Legacy
Last night, the company and audience of Cabaret at the Kit Kat Club celebrated Broadway legend Joel Grey’s 92nd birthday on stage at the August Wilson Theatre.
By: A.A. CristiApr. 12, 2024, Broadway World.
Last night, the company of Cabaret at the Kit Kat Club wilkommened some very special guests to their immersive nightclub home!
Eddie Redmayne currently in previews as the ‘Emcee’ in Cabaret at the Kit Kat Club celebrated Broadway legend Joel Grey’s 92nd birthday on stage at the August Wilson Theatre.
In the video Grey, who won Tony and Academy Awards for originating the role of the Emcee, reacts to the immersive new production now in previews on Broadway and its star Eddie Redmayne.
Redmayne described the feeling of performing for Grey and the show's composer, John Kander as "extraordinary, horrendously intimidating, as well, but joyful," and revealed a special moment he shared with the star during the performance.
Grey, who originated the role of the ‘Emcee’ on Broadway in 1966 and went on to star in the beloved film of Cabaret, took the stage as the entire cast, band, and creative team sang “Happy Birthday” while a custom cake, shaped like a giant pineapple, emerged from the stage.
During his speech honoring Grey, Eddie Redmayne said, “Tonight is an extraordinarily special night for us because we are in the presence of an extraordinary human being without whom none of us would be here.” After thunderous applause, Redmayne continued “Your performance in this part changed my life and it was one of the things that made me want to be an actor.”
The cast and Grey were also joined on stage by Cabaret composer John Kander.
Alongside Joel’s daughter Jennifer Grey and Kander, a star-studded crowd came out to fete the theater icon including Anderson Cooper, Candice Bergen, Jackie Hoffman, Jane Krakowski, Lin-Manuel Miranda, David Rockwell, and more. They were joined by numerous alum of Cabaret spanning the decades including Maude Apatow (Sally Bowles in London, 2023), Madeline Brewer (Sally Bowles in London, 2022), Joely Fisher (Sally Bowles on Broadway, 2000), Gina Gershon (Sally Bowles on Broadway, 2001), Mason Alexander Park (Emcee in London, 2023), Adam Pascal (Emcee on Broadway, 2003), Molly Ringwald (Sally Bowles on Broadway, 2002), Jake Shears (Emcee in London, 2023), and Brooke Shields (Sally Bowles on Broadway, 2001).

Send in the Clowns - Glynis Johns (BBC Documentary Footage)
The great Glynis Johns, the original Desiree Armfeldt in Stephen Sondheim’s masterpiece, A Little Night Music, performs “Send in the Clowns.”  For her role as Desiree Armfeldt, she won a Tony Award for Best Actress in a Musical and Drama Desk Award for Outstanding Actress in a Musical.
She turns 100 years old today, October 5, 2023.
Glynis Margaret Payne Johns (born 5 October 1923) is a British retired actress, dancer, musician and singer. Recognized as an icon of screen and stage, Johns has a career spanning eight decades, in which she appeared in more than 60 films and 30 plays. She is the recipient of awards and nominations in various drama award denominations, including the National Board of Review of Motion Pictures, the Academy Awards, the Golden Globe Awards, the Laurel Awards, the Tony Awards, the Drama Desk Awards and the Laurence Olivier Awards, within which she has won two thirds of her nominations.
She is more familiar to many as Winifred Banks, the wife of George Banks, mother of Jane and Michael, and member of Emmeline Pankhurst's "Votes for Women" suffrage movement, to which she is completely dedicated, in Mary Poppins (1964), considered to be Walt Disney's crowning live-action film achievement.

Frances Hussey Sternhagen (January 13, 1930 – November 27, 2023) Stage, film and television actress. Sternhagen was known as a character actress who appeared on- and off-Broadway, in movies, and on television for over six decades. She received numerous accolades including two Tony Awards, a Drama Desk Award, a Saturn Award, as well as nominations for three Primetime Emmy Awards.
She worked for many years in soap operas such as Another World, The Secret Storm, Love of Life, and The Doctors, and she played two roles on One Life to Live. She is also recognized as Mrs. Marsh from a series of television commercials for Colgate toothpaste that aired in the 1970s.
She gained prominence and Primetime Emmy Award nominations for her recurring roles as Esther Clavin in the NBC sitcom Cheers (1986 - 1993) and Bunny MacDougal in the HBO series Sex and the City (2000–2002). She also had recurring roles in the NBC medical drama ER (1994–2009), and the TNT series The Closer (2006–2012).

HAYDN GYWNNE (1957-Died October 20th 2023,at 66.Cancer).English actress. She was nominated for the 1992 BAFTA TV Award for Best Light Entertainment Performance for the comedy series Drop the Dead Donkey (1990–1991), and won the 2009 Drama Desk Award for Outstanding Featured Actress in a Musical for her role in the Broadway production of Billy Elliot the Musical. She was also a four-time Olivier Award nominee. Her other television roles included Peak Practice (1999–2000), Merseybeat (2001–2002), and playing Camilla in The Windsors (2016–2023).Haydn Gwynne - Wikipedia

'Premiered on 4 April 2024, this period thriller drama will take viewers back to 1960s Italy with Andrew Scott stepping into the shoes of notorious grifter Tom Ripley in the new Netflix series.
While Patricia Highsmith’s bestselling Tom Ripley novels have been morphed for page-to-screen adaptation several times, it is the 1999 film The Talented Mr Ripley, starring Matt Damon, Gwyneth Paltrow and Jude Law, that has become a classic favourite among cinephiles. If you have seen it, you might have a fair idea of what you’re getting into.
The TV series, helmed by Academy Award winner Steven Zaillian, depicts a compelling journey back in time via black-and-white frames. Coupled with gripping performances by the entire cast, the new take on The Talented Mr Ripley renders a rather ominous vibe to the plot.
With so much being talked about and mystery swelling around the complex life of Tom Ripley, the natural question is are any more seasons scheduled for release?
Will there be a season 2 of Ripley on Netflix? Here’s what we know
What is Ripley about?
Though viewers are no strangers to the dark world of Highsmith’s morally dubious character Tom Ripley, the story gets an episodic makeover as a 2024 Netflix show.
The eight-part story revolves around the protagonist Tom Ripley (Scott), a small-time swindler in 1960s New York. His life turns around when a wealthy man hires him to travel to Italy and convince his trifler son, Dickie Greenleaf (Johnny Flynn), to return home. Accepting this offer was just the first step towards a descent into a world of deception, fraud and murder. When he reaches the serene town of Atrani where Dickie is perfectly settled with his writer girlfriend Marge Sherwood (Dakota Fanning), Tom is awe-struck by his lavish lifestyle. A clever presentation of truth with an unmissable charm is enough to get the master con artist into Dickie’s good books. From here, Tom climbs his way up into Dickie’s close quarters and ends up going to extreme lengths to make that life his own.
Each episode has a runtime of about 50 minutes, while the finale is 74 minutes long.
Ripley is based on which book?
Highsmith’s Ripley books make up a series of five novels, dubbed ‘Ripliad’, which debuted in 1955 with The Talented Mr Ripley.
Netflix’s Ripley is based on this first book. It is followed by other titles — Ripley Under Ground (1970), Ripley’s Game (1974), The Boy Who Followed Ripley (1980) and Ripley Under Water (1981).
Speaking to Vanity Fair in December 2023, Zaillian said, “Almost 70 years after Highsmith created him, contemporary figures are still being compared to him. He won’t go away.”
Interestingly enough, the book also led to the evocative monochrome filming style. “The edition of the Ripley book I had on my desk had an evocative black-and-white photograph on the cover,” Zaillian said.
“As I was writing, I held that image in my mind. Black and white fits this story — and it’s gorgeous,” he added.
The Ripley cast and crew
Besides Andrew Scott, Johnny Flynn and Dakota Fanning the cast also includes Eliot Sumner as Freddie Miles, who suspected the diabolical nature of Tom’s congeniality, Maurizio Lombardi as Inspector Ravini and John Malkovich as Reeves Minot.
In March 2024, Town & Country quoted Scott commenting about portraying the titular character. He said, “I feel like you’re required to love and advocate for your characters, and your job is to go, Why? What’s that? You don’t play the opinions, the previous attitudes that people might have about Tom Ripley. You have to throw all those out, try not to listen to them, and go, Okay, well, I have to have the courage to create our own version and my own understanding of the character.”
The project is written, directed and executive produced by Zaillian. Besides him, other executive producers include Garrett Basch, Clayton Townsend, Guymon Casady, Benjamin Forkner, Sharon Levy and Philipp Keel.
How does Ripley end?
The brilliant chiaroscuro acts as an omnipresent cast member throughout the series, accentuating the sombre tone, which almost reaches a crescendo in the eighth episode. By the end of the final episode, titled Narcissus, Tom Ripley has a body count of two — Freddie Miles and Dickie Greenleaf — and has successfully ripped off Dickie’s life by using his name and money. However, the Italian police are after him for one crime he didn’t commit, the murder of Tom Ripley.
Seizing the perfect opportunity, Tom plays another card by conveniently walking into the police resuming his own identity. He manages to convince Inspector Ravini, Marge and Mr Greenleaf that Dickie died, albeit with strong undercurrents of suspense and tension that could make viewers sit up anxiously, as there are pressing moments when his deceit is on the verge of spilling out.
Once the dust is settled and mystery is buried like Dickie’s corpse at sea, Tom Ripley plays another con trick to begin his new life as Timothy Fanshaw, but that is another story to tell.
Production and filming of Ripley
The Ripley series was originally being developed by Showtime, but Netflix picked it up in 2023 while it was in post-production. The principal shooting took place in Italy — Rome and Venice — in accordance with the book’s setting. Certain portions were also filmed in New York to capture the 1960s vibe of the city.
Economic Times states that although production was slated to begin in 2020, it got delayed until 2021 for certain reasons.
Will there be a Ripley season 2?
Netflix has billed it as a limited series. The episodes have rounded up both the plot quite well, though certain creative liberties from the book make it somewhat ambiguous.
Although there is no official nod from Netflix about a second season, the OTT platform states, “But given the opportunity, Zaillian would love to continue to adapt the affectionately nicknamed ‘Ripliad’.”
Speaking to Tudum in April 2024, Zaillian said, “I think that the other books are good, and we see Tom in a lot of different ways as he grows up.” Who knows, this can be a step towards creating a ‘Ripliad’ franchise by expanding Tom Ripley’s world.
